QA Engineer

QA Engineer


Relocation or Remote | full time

Hypeskill

Job description

We are seeking a skilled and experienced middle QA Engineer to join our team at Hyperskill. You'll have the opportunity to work on cutting-edge technology, building and executing automated tests for web applications using Python, Selenium, and Pytest, and play a key role in ensuring that our software products are of the highest quality by identifying, reporting, and helping to resolve defects. If you're ready for a challenge and want to be a part of a dynamic and innovative team, we want to hear from you!

Primary Responsibilities:

  • Develop, maintain, and execute automated test cases using Python, Selenium, Pytest, Page Object, and Requests;
  • Execute manual regression testing;
  • Create detailed, comprehensive, and well-structured test plans and test cases;
  • Collaborate with development and product teams to understand requirements and design test cases;
  • Work with the team to improve the test automation framework and infrastructure;
  • Analyze and report test results and provide feedback to stakeholders.

Requirements:

  • 2+ years of experience in testing web applications;
  • 1,5+ years of experience in creating and maintaining automated tests in Python and related tools (Selenium, Pytest, and Requests);
  • Knowledge of patterns for automation (PageObject and its variations) and ability to work with them;
  • Excellent communication skills and the ability to work with teams across different departments;
  • A desire for professional growth, and the confidence to defend ideas and engage in discussions.

We offer:

  • Work with a global IT product in the EdTech field with the perspective of fast growth;
  • Completely remote, flexible work format without micromanagement;
  • Bonuses after the probation period: corporate budget (for health insurance, education, technical equipment) and unlimited paid vacations.

Contact info: 

join@hyperskill.org




Report Page